A Litman Fund Drops Copper Rock

The Litman Gregory Masters Smaller Companies Fund has made a roster change.

Effective December 1, Turner Investments was added as a sub-advisor, and Frank Sustersic was added as a portfolio manager, to the fund, according to a Securities and Exchange Commission filing.

The new sub-advisor replaced outgoing Copper Rock Capital Partners and PM Tucker Walsh. The fund’s remaining sub-advisors currently include Cove Street Capital, Friess Associates, First Pacific Advisors and Wells Capital Management.

The 3-star rated fund launched in June 2003 and currently manages some $69.9 million in assets. It has an expense ratio of 154 basis points
